亲爱的读者,你是否曾对那些在数字世界中闪烁着光芒的加密货币感到好奇?它们是如何运作的?又是如何构建起一个庞大的系统架构的呢?今天,就让我们一起揭开加密货币系统架构的神秘面纱,一探究竟吧!
一、加密货币的起源与定义

加密货币,顾名思义,是一种利用密码学原理来保证交易安全、控制货币发行和验证交易的数字货币。它起源于2009年,由一个化名为“中本聪”的人或团队创立,这就是比特币。自那时起,加密货币如雨后春笋般涌现,逐渐成为全球金融领域的一股不可忽视的力量。
二、加密货币系统架构的核心要素

1. 区块链技术

区块链是加密货币系统架构的核心,它是一种去中心化的分布式账本技术。简单来说,区块链就像一个巨大的账本,记录着所有交易信息。每个区块都包含一定数量的交易记录,并通过密码学算法与前一个区块连接,形成一个不可篡改的链。
2. 加密算法
加密算法是保证加密货币交易安全的关键。常见的加密算法有SHA-256、ECDSA等。这些算法能够确保交易数据的完整性和隐私性,防止恶意攻击者篡改或窃取数据。
3. 共识机制
共识机制是区块链网络中节点之间达成一致意见的机制。目前,常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。这些机制确保了区块链网络的稳定性和安全性。
4. 智能合约
智能合约是一种自动执行合约条款的程序。在加密货币系统中,智能合约可以自动执行交易、支付等操作,提高了交易效率和安全性。
三、加密货币系统架构的优势与挑战
1. 优势
(1)去中心化:加密货币系统架构去除了传统金融体系中的中介机构,降低了交易成本,提高了交易效率。
(2)安全性:加密算法和共识机制保证了交易的安全性,降低了欺诈风险。
(3)透明性:区块链技术使得交易信息公开透明,便于监管和审计。
2. 挑战
(1)技术难题:区块链技术仍处于发展阶段,存在扩展性、能耗等问题。
(2)监管风险:加密货币市场存在监管不明确、非法交易等问题。
(3)市场波动:加密货币价格波动较大,投资者需谨慎投资。
四、加密货币系统架构的未来展望
随着区块链技术的不断成熟,加密货币系统架构将在以下几个方面得到发展:
1. 技术优化:提高区块链的扩展性、降低能耗,使其更适用于大规模应用。
2. 监管完善:加强监管,规范市场秩序,降低非法交易风险。
3. 应用拓展:加密货币系统架构将在供应链、金融、医疗等领域得到广泛应用。
加密货币系统架构作为一种新兴的金融技术,正逐渐改变着我们的生活方式。了解其运作原理,有助于我们更好地把握这一趋势,为未来的发展做好准备。让我们一起期待加密货币系统架构的辉煌未来吧!